There is one solution that may help : the dog gate. Dog gates are handy in keeping your over-destructive, hyper-active, separation agitation ridden dog in one area of the house. This way, you can curb elimination and teach the dog the value of bounds. Dog gates come in numerous designs nowadays, but the essential concept of most is simple - the gate is either pressure mounted or screwed into the wall. Some are extra wide, some are extra tall, and some open up when you release a latch so you can walk through while not having to train for Olympic hurdles.

Naturally, the most secure gates in the world will not do you any good if your dog does not understand boundaries once the gates are down.

For some dogs, the difficulties may be separation stress. For other dogs, it's discipline Problems. For both issues, there are a couple of things you can do to help the issue before it gets out of hand. First, break a pattern while it's beginning. This implies that if your dog gets riled up as you are leaving, don't leave in the same order. Do not make a big fuss about leaving. It should all be uneventful and not in an order that the dog can forecast. Then leave the house quietly. Breaking the pattern of leaving can help the dog to not get so worked up to start with.

If it is a behaviour issue, and you know how your dog looks when he's going to get beyond control, break the behavior before it starts. If he is generally a harmful dog, ripping into your couch on a consistent basis, stop the dog before he even starts to gnaw - when you see those first alarm signals of the behaviour beginning. Does he start panting and getting excited? Is there another behaviour that triggers this one? Do you see him heading towards the lounger?

Stop him before he even gets there, show him to a corner, have him sit down, and make sure he stays there until he calms down. A great way to make certain that your dog is nice and calm before you even leave the house is to take him on a walk - 30 minutes to an hour depending on the dog's energy level. A tired dog is less likely to be hunting for things to break and less certain to be concerned as you leave. For more about obedience coaching, click right here.
